

Nestled in the Pennsylvania Wilds, Colton Point State Park offers stunning views of the Pine Creek Gorge, known as the 'Grand Canyon of the East'.

Colton Point State Park is known for sudden rain showers, especially in the mountains.

The park has numerous trails with varied terrain, requiring sturdy footwear.
The park is home to diverse wildlife and scenic views, perfect for birdwatching and sightseeing.
